Sought-after stars such as The War & Treaty, Tunde Olaniran, Lady Ace Boogie, Luke Winslow King and Molly will join emerging artists Pink Sky, Earth Radio, LVRS, Michigander and others to pump up the evening, leading up to the “Big Jammie” – the album of the year – presented at the end of the night. (The Mint on the lower level will serve as an open-mic venue). The evening honoring the best local and regional releases of 2018 will feature performances by more than 30 bands on three stages, using all four venues inside The Intersection for the first time in the 20-year history of the Jammies. It’s “West Michigan music’s biggest night of the year” and, in this case, it’s the biggest Jammie Awards show that community radio station WYCE-FM has ever staged.
